Albert Einstein Essay
Albert Einstein was a German American scientist. He is best known for his theories on relativity and theories of matter and heat. Einstein is considered one of the greatest physicists of all time because he is thought to have changed the way one looks at the universe. Medical
Definition of Thrombocytopenia Thrombocytopenia is a condition in which there is a deficient number of circulating platelets. Description of Thrombocytopenia Thrombocytopenia may be congenital or acquired. The acquired form is more common, especially among elderly.
